Trader murder

Buxar, April 19: Surendra Kumar Gupta, the owner of a poultry farm in Dumraon, was today shot dead by motorbike-borne criminals at his shop near the Dumraon police station. Police said the motive behind the murder of Gupta, a resident of Shapur in Bhojpur district, was yet to be ascertained.

Road mishap

Bettiah: Three people were killed and 12 others injured when two sports utility vehicles collided on the Bettiah-Areraj road in West Champaran district late on Monday night. The victims were returning from Bettiah after attending a wedding ceremony. The injured were rushed to a local government hospital.

Clash

Sasaram: Group clashes broke out in the Bikramganj sub-divisional town of Rohtas district during a procession late on Monday night. Additional security forces have been deployed in the town to keep tabs on the troublemakers.

Raids

Saharsa: Police are yet to make a breakthrough in the murder of Saharsa RJD youth wing district president Shaymsunder Tanti. Saharsa deputy superintendent of police Subodh Kumar Biswas said raids have been carried out at different hideouts of the suspects.
